WorkOS vs. BetterAuth vs. Clerk: Which should you choose?
Blog post from WorkOS
Choosing the right authentication solution is crucial for applications, and several options like WorkOS, Better Auth, and Clerk present distinct advantages and limitations based on different needs. WorkOS is an excellent choice for B2B SaaS applications as it offers comprehensive enterprise-ready features such as SSO, SCIM directory sync, audit logs, and a self-service admin portal, with a pricing model that scales predictably for enterprise customers. Better Auth, being an open-source TypeScript framework, provides complete control over authentication infrastructure, appealing to startups with strong DevOps capabilities who want to avoid per-user costs, although it lacks enterprise features like SSO and SCIM out of the box. Clerk, on the other hand, emphasizes rapid integration and developer experience with pre-built UI components, making it suitable for consumer applications, but its lack of SCIM support and complex pricing model may become limiting for enterprise-focused B2B SaaS companies. Each platform serves different scenarios, and selecting the wrong one can lead to significant business risks, such as lost deals and costly migrations, thus the decision should align with long-term growth plans and customer needs.